Question 1 of 5

A nurse is caring for a client who is taking sertraline and reports a desire to begin taking supplements. Which of the following supplements should the nurse advise the client to avoid?

Correct Answer: A

Rationale: The correct answer is A: St. John's Wort. Sertraline is an antidepressant that affects serotonin levels. St. John's Wort is an herbal supplement that also impacts serotonin levels, potentially leading to serotonin syndrome when taken together.
Therefore, the nurse should advise the client to avoid St. John's Wort to prevent adverse effects.

Choices B, C, and D do not have known interactions with sertraline and can be safely taken.
